About Office Downlights
Office Downlights for Focused and Functional Workspaces
Office downlights shape how a workspace feels and functions long before anyone sits down to work. The right fixture selection and placement reduce eye strain, eliminate glare across monitor screens, and maintain a consistent light level that keeps focus steady across the full working day. Whether the space is a private study, a corporate suite, or a home office that doubles as a creative studio, recessed downlights offer a ceiling-integrated solution that keeps the architecture clean and places the emphasis where it belongs: on the work itself.

What separates a thoughtful office lighting plan from a frustrating one is attention to beam angle, color temperature, and fixture spacing. A single overhead source creates hotspots and shadow zones that force the eye to constantly readjust. A well-placed grid of quality office downlights distributes illumination evenly across desks and floors, reduces contrast fatigue, and adapts to different task needs within a single room.
Why LED Technology Defines Modern Office Downlights
LED technology has become the standard for office downlights because it delivers the performance profile that workspace lighting demands: high output per watt, operational life measured in tens of thousands of hours, and color accuracy that supports detail work. Most office fixtures draw between 7 and 25 watts while producing lumen outputs that cover standard ceiling grids comfortably. A quality LED downlight rated at 80 CRI or higher reproduces surface colors accurately, which matters in design studios, photography workspaces, and any environment where visual judgment is part of the daily workflow.
Color Temperature for Office Settings
Color temperature is among the most impactful choices in any office lighting plan. Fixtures in the 3000K to 3500K range emit a warm white suited to executive offices, private studies, and hybrid home-work environments where comfort across long sessions is a priority. Fixtures at 4000K produce a neutral to cool white that promotes alertness and clarity, making them the standard choice for open-plan offices, conference rooms, and detail-focused workstations. Tunable white LED downlights support both ranges within a single fixture, allowing color temperature to shift across the workday and align with natural light cycles.
Recessed, Trimless, and Surface Mount Styles
Three installation formats cover the majority of office downlight applications. Fully recessed downlights sit inside the ceiling cavity with a visible trim ring finishing the aperture, available in 4-inch and 6-inch sizes as the most widely specified type for drywall and suspended tile ceilings. Trimless office downlights integrate flush with the ceiling plane without a visible border, producing a monolithic finish suited to contemporary interiors and minimalist commercial environments. Each format supports the same LED sources and beam angle options, so the choice of style does not require a compromise on optical performance or energy efficiency.
Surface Mount and Semi-Recessed Options
Surface mount downlights project below the ceiling line and require no ceiling cavity, making them practical for concrete slab construction or renovations where ceiling access is limited. Semi-recessed fixtures partially insert into a shallow void while exposing a visible lower housing that adds its own design character. Both types offer the same dimming compatibility and beam control as fully recessed models, ensuring that installation flexibility does not come at the cost of light quality in demanding office environments.
Placement and Spacing for Office Downlight Layouts
Thoughtful placement turns individual fixtures into a cohesive lighting system. Standard practice positions office downlights at spacing between 1.0 and 1.5 times the ceiling height, measured center to center. At a ceiling of 2.7 meters, that places fixtures between 2.7 and 4 meters apart with even coverage. Maintaining at least 600mm of clearance from walls prevents the shadowed gradients that make vertical surfaces appear dim. Task-intensive areas such as drafting tables and multi-monitor workstations often benefit from a tighter secondary grid of lower-wattage fixtures rather than relying solely on the ambient layer.
Adjustable and Gimbal Downlights for Task Zones
Adjustable downlights incorporate a tilting or rotating mechanism that directs the beam toward a chosen surface rather than projecting straight down. This is useful at the perimeter of an office where desks sit beneath angled sections, in conference rooms where a presentation wall needs directional light, and in showroom-style offices where displays require accent coverage alongside ambient illumination. Gimbal models rotate through a full 360-degree sweep, providing the widest repositioning range within a fixed ceiling aperture as office layouts evolve.
Dimmable Office Downlights and Lighting Controls
Dimmable office downlights are increasingly standard in modern lighting specifications rather than a premium addition. The ability to reduce output during video calls, shift to lower ambient levels for late-evening sessions, or soften the room for client meetings gives a space functional range that fixed-output fixtures cannot match. LED office downlights require a compatible LED dimmer rather than a legacy incandescent control to prevent flicker and shortened lamp life. In multi-zone layouts, scene control systems group fixtures by area and allow single-touch presets that shift the room between meeting mode, focused task mode, and relaxed ambient settings throughout the day.
